Output 532f8d7e637981606cd2ab14213aedd5f93265051558f7327f89b0b790be1892:9

value
2555139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f38256b4cf31781ec41d36cac990918c462bf7a OP_EQUAL
address
3GCtd9bPdqZJEzS2v1Z3sMmKjs2iWGpg4n
transaction
532f8d7e637981606cd2ab14213aedd5f93265051558f7327f89b0b790be1892
spent
true